A collection of three films starring the lovable Winnie The Pooh and the gang. WINNIE THE POOH MOVIE - Christopher Robin is in danger, and it's up to Pooh, Rabbit, Piglet, Kanga, Roo, and Eeyore to help their old friend out of harm's way. But when the whole gang comes running at Owl's behest, they realize that someone's imagination has gotten the best of them. HEFFALUMP MOVIE - When Winnie the Pooh (voice of Jim Cummings) hears a strange noise in the woods, he and his friends are convinced that the dreaded Heffalump -- a critter not unlike an elephant -- has come to the woods to do them harm. Pooh, Piglet (voice of John Fiedler), and Tigger (also voiced by Cummings) set out to capture the fearsome beast, but Roo (voice of Jimmy Bennett), who is told he's too small to join the search party, meets Lumpy the Heffalump face to face and discovers he's not the bad guy he's been made out to be. TIGGER MOVIE - Tigger is having a hard time finding anyone to play with him, so he decides to track down his family tree and find other Tiggers. Concerned that their friend feels sad, Winnie and his friends dress up like Tiggers so he won't feel so alone. But once Tigger finds out who they really are, it makes him even more determined to find his real family. As Tigger heads out in search of others like himself, he accidentally makes his way into a snowstorm, and Winnie and friends must find him before he gets lost in the cold.Product Identifiers
